Output 76633da9d220115609888dd1d0fcb6ca08f8ea04dda83645c6b223b37c0d6618:6

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89f54b4457f43ce6db16f345f668b523d61024e OP_EQUAL
address
3KyowQv8XX5Pi93Uazc5e2kM5QeWY61eCP
transaction
76633da9d220115609888dd1d0fcb6ca08f8ea04dda83645c6b223b37c0d6618
spent
true